Snorkeling and Diving at John Pennekamp Coral Reef State Park
John Pennekamp Coral Reef State Park is one of Key Largo’s top attractions, and for good reason. It is the first undersea park in the United States and protects miles of coral reefs and marine life.
Visitors can snorkel or dive in shallow reef areas filled with colorful fish, sea fans, and living coral. Boat tours make it easy for beginners, while experienced divers can explore deeper sections with a guide.
Other activities at the park include kayaking, glass-bottom boat tours, and short nature trails. It is an excellent place for families and first-time visitors looking for iconic things to do in Key Largo, Florida.

See the “Christ of the Abyss” Underwater Statue
One of the most recognizable sights in Key Largo is the “Christ of the Abyss” statue. This submerged bronze sculpture rests about 25 feet below the surface and has become a popular snorkeling and diving destination.
The statue stands with arms raised, surrounded by schools of fish and coral growth. Visibility is often good, making it accessible even for casual snorkelers.

Cruise on the Historic African Queen
Step aboard the African Queen. This historic steam-powered boat starred in the classic 1951 film and still operates today.
Cruises take place along calm canals and offer a relaxed way to learn about local history. The experience feels personal, with small group sizes and a slower pace.

Go to the Blond Giraffe Key Lime Pie Factory
No trip to the Keys is complete without a pit stop at the Blond Giraffe Key Lime Pie Factory. Their signature treat—a slice of tart, creamy key lime pie frozen on a stick and dipped in dark chocolate—is the ultimate tropical indulgence.
There is also a small shop with souvenirs and shaded seating. It is a simple pleasure that appeals to travelers of all ages. This stop works well between activities and offers a taste of local flavor without taking up too much time.
